当前位置: 首页 >
为什么 Golang 不适合开发桌面系统?
- 人气:
goroutine 这个号称最适合开发网络应用的东西用在客户端上就是最大的拖油瓶。
用户态线程最大的劣势就是 native 调用,因为每次调用你都得绑到一个系统线程上并且构建 native 栈才能可靠地完成调用。
然而要开发客户端你总得有个***循环线程吧,然后所有其他地方处理的东西要想反映在 UI 上就必须要把操作打包塞进***循环里等待被调度到主线程上去做。
那么现在问题来了,你的***循环和其他各种***处理都是 goroutine,鉴于客…。
推荐资讯
- 2025-06-21你们认为一个40多岁的女人老吗?
- 2025-06-21能分享一下你写过的rust项目吗?
- 2025-06-21为什么浙江落下的陨石,防空系统没有拦截,它和导弹有什么不同?
- 2025-06-21中美会因台海开战吗?
- 2025-06-21有外媒记者提问,台湾当局称,在过去24小时内,46架解放军战机飞越台湾。有何最新消息吗?
- 2025-06-21如何使用hexo+github搭建华丽博客 ,类似***://codingxiaxw.cn/的博客?
- 2025-06-21如何看待rust编写的zed编辑器?
- 2025-06-21男朋友说我穿衣服太开放,难道好身材不应该显示出来吗?
- 2025-06-2130马赫的导弹,近防炮能挡住吗?
- 2025-06-21据说Rust和WASM可以让J***ascript变得更强,有值得推荐的项目吗?
- 2025-06-21做引体向上可能会诱发腰肌劳损吗?
- 2025-06-21组装2-4人后端服务团队,选择GO还是J***a?
- 2025-06-21网络游戏服务器开发,有哪些经典书籍?
- 2025-06-21如何使Windows上安装的Macos虚拟机流畅运行?
- 2025-06-21医院为什么很不用安宫牛黄丸急救?
- 2025-06-21应该如何看待群晖在DSM 7.2.2-72803更新中去掉了Video Station?
推荐产品
-
2025年6月,到底买油车还是电车?
我的油车 15年的阿特兹 一年油费4000 保险3100 保 -
网传厦门某国企研发部门要求每日考察后端 400 行,前端 1000 行代码量,如属实,这个考核合理吗?
我前司搞过一次,让我用Python统计gitlab提交代码量 -
你后悔娶了现在老婆吗?
不后悔,说说我们的情况吧,我92年生,离过一次婚,因为工作原 -
作为一个服务器,node.js 是性能最高的吗?
嘿,兄弟们!今天你焦虑了吗? 反正我朋友圈的 JS 开发者群
最新资讯